The stock hit a 52-week high of Rs 35.55, up 6.27 per cent, on BSE.
On NSE, too, it scaled a 52-week high at Rs 35.60, up 6.58 per cent.
The company had reported a net loss of Rs 100.6 crore in the fourth quarter of the previous fiscal.
In a BSE filing yesterday, NFL said its net income rose to Rs 1,641.7 crore in the quarter ended March 2016, from Rs 1,556.3 crore in the year-ago period.
For 2015-16, NFL reported a significant jump in its consolidated net profit at Rs 197.1 crore, from Rs 26.2 crore in the year-ago period.
For the entire year, total income of the company fell to Rs 7,776.4 crore, from Rs 8,524.9 crore a year earlier. However, expenses were lower at Rs 7,300.9 crore in 2015-16 as against Rs 8,210.7 crore in the previous year.
